## BloomGate — quick tour for reviewers

Hey, thanks for taking a look. BloomGate sits in front of our Kestrel key-value store and answers "definitely not here" before a lookup ever hits disk. False positive rate is tuned to about 0.5%, rebuilds run nightly. It's read-only from the client's perspective — only the rebuild job writes. For poking at the admin endpoints in staging, BloomGate expects the service key included below.

app token of tadug-yahag = vxb3-949

Reseller Programme Overview — Managers Only, Ashquill Instruments

This page summarises the Keldway reseller programme for the incoming director. Tiers are based on annual sell-through, with training and demo stock provided at silver level and above. Margin structures were revised last quarter after partner feedback. Onboarding takes roughly six weeks per partner. The strategic direction planned for the programme is set out in the confidential note below.

management briefing: The renewal with Zoraelax Group closes at $10 million a year, 15 percent below the last contract. Project Ralael slips by six weeks because of the audit delay.

Action item from the Mirewater tide-table widget incident. Owner: release manager. Widget cached stale harbor offsets after the DST change, showing tides six hours off for two days. Required: add a cache-invalidation check to the release checklist, block deploys when offset tables are older than 24 hours, and verify the Saltgate harbor feed before each cut. Deadline: next release. Checklist template and sign-off procedure are documented on the internal page below.

wiki page, kawif-bajep: https://artifactory.zarqelforge.internal/issue/browse/display/display/projects/spaces/secrets/000fe6ec5a46af29355003e1

TURN-208: Gatevale turnstile counters at the Merrow Field pilot double-count when a rotation reverses mid-cycle. Attendance totals drift roughly 2% high per event. The debounce window fix is implemented, reviewed by Ilsa, and soak-tested across two simulated match days without drift. Ready for your cut; the candidate build is identified below.

trace token, tagag-tafog: htk6_5ed18c